通过使用Display()函数来实现Python的数据可视化
发布时间:2023-12-25 09:22:52
数据可视化是将数据以图表、图形等形式展示出来,便于人们更直观地理解和分析数据的一种方法。
在Python中,可以使用许多库来实现数据可视化,如Matplotlib、Seaborn、Plotly等。其中,Matplotlib是最常用的数据可视化库之一,提供了丰富的函数和方法来创建各种类型的图表。
在Matplotlib中,Display()函数是用于显示图表的一个重要函数。它可以在Jupyter Notebook中直接显示图表,而不需要调用其他的显示函数。
以下是一个实现数据可视化的例子,使用Matplotlib库中的Display()函数来显示一个柱状图:
import matplotlib.pyplot as plt
# 定义数据
labels = ['A', 'B', 'C', 'D']
values = [10, 30, 20, 40]
# 绘制柱状图
plt.bar(labels, values)
# 设置标题和标签
plt.title('Example Bar Chart')
plt.xlabel('Categories')
plt.ylabel('Values')
# 显示图表
plt.display()
运行以上代码,就会在Jupyter Notebook中显示一个柱状图,其中横轴表示类别,纵轴表示值。可以使用Display()函数来显示各种类型的图表,如折线图、散点图、饼图等。
除了使用Matplotlib库,还可以使用其他数据可视化库来实现类似的功能。例如,使用Seaborn库可以快速绘制一些常见的统计图表,如箱线图、热力图等。
import seaborn as sns
# 定义数据
tips = sns.load_dataset('tips')
# 绘制箱线图
sns.boxplot(x='day', y='total_bill', data=tips)
# 设置标题和标签
plt.title('Example Box Plot')
plt.xlabel('Day')
plt.ylabel('Total Bill')
# 显示图表
plt.display()
以上代码使用Seaborn库绘制了一个箱线图,其中横轴表示天数,纵轴表示账单总额。
通过以上例子可以看出,使用Display()函数可以方便地显示各种类型的图表,并且可以与其他数据可视化库结合使用。数据可视化不仅可以提供更直观的数据展示方式,还可以帮助人们更好地理解和分析数据,从而做出更有针对性的决策。
